Abstract
The aim of this paper is based on the results of the literature review and questionnaires,combined with the methods of big data analysis algorithms,analysis of variance, analysis of regression, analysis Of Effects and other methods to explore the development of digital financial finance in rural areas, studies the frequency of residents' monthly credit loans, studies the education level, monthly income, and the advantages and disadvantages of financial institutions. According to the results of analysis of correlation and data model fitting, age, cognition of the advantages of financial institutions significantly affect the frequency of residents 'average monthly use of credit loans and residents' digital inclusive finance Amount of financing obtained. The government and financial institutions can refer to the research and suggestions to optimize the policies, improve the current existing problems, accelerate the speed of financial innovation, and promote the rapid development of inclusive finance.
